John, would it be right to believe that seeing some of the timestamps on scheduled builds this week, that timestamps are not really important?
For this week? So far, the FE that is scheduled for us is the first FE on our list.
Timestamps do matter.
Here's some new info for everyone considering Ford's efforts at scheduling:
Of the four FEs within our first 17 customers in timestamp order, only one is Leather/Grey seats (which was scheduled yesterday), the other three are Leather/Black and DID NOT GET SCHEDULED yesterday, Ford did not move up any of the other FEs into those slots, so, next week, as Ford told me this morning, I expect ALL remaining slots in our June allotment to go toward standard models.
Per Ford: "..... First Edition is in recognition to the First Model Year, not First in production. Timing for production will vary based on a number of factors including: reservation timestamp, vehicle model and configuration selected and part constraints."
